I've been unhappy with the registrar for one of my domains for a
while, so I decided to let my domain with them expire (that was my
only way out, as they refused transfer without my renewing for 2 more
years at a steep price).

However, now that the domain is expired they claim they have it in
pending-delete status, but the current whois record is marked valid
until Jan 9, 2011.

I'd like to register my domain with another registrar before then, and
I wonder if I have any claims to make... I've tried to read up on
whois conventions, and pending-delete seems like a very temporary
status (5-7 days), so I don't understand why they would block it for a
year.

In earlier support correspondence they mentioned a period of ~40 days
where the domain would be in quarantine, but a whole year seems
unrealistic.

Can they do this? Who do I complain to?
